About the Role
The Service Administrator role in Bradwell involves full-time work, Monday to Friday from 8.30am to 5.30pm, with a salary between £30,000 and £32,000. You will join a supportive team focused on delivering excellent customer service and ensuring smooth operational processes. Key duties include managing service contracts, processing invoicing, resolving customer queries, and coordinating maintenance schedules. Strong organisational abilities and a customer-focused approach are essential, as you will liaise with clients, engineers, and internal departments. This position requires someone who thrives on variety and takes pride in providing first-class administrative support within a busy service environment.

What you'll be doing
- Processing service administration, including raising invoices and credit notes across multiple customer sectors.
- Managing and resolving invoice queries efficiently and professionally.
- Uploading invoices and supporting documentation to customer portals.
- Producing customer and internal reports as required.
- Managing monthly key account invoicing and maintaining accurate customer asset lists.
- Handling incoming telephone calls from customers and colleagues, providing a professional and helpful service.
- Administering service contracts, including preparing quotations for new contracts and renewals.
- Following up on contract opportunities and equipment approaching the end of its warranty.
- Coordinating and managing planned maintenance visit schedules.
- Supporting the wider Service Administration team with day-to-day operational activities.
- Providing scheduling support during busy periods and holiday cover.
